After a little artful stitching and some mild invasive surgery I've Jury rigged you a Trainible knockout beast. I call it a Popper Dog. Its just a dog, but this dog has a syndrome filled gas for blood. It's not lethal but it will cause quick unconsciousness,dizziness, drowsiness and vomiting. Basically, it's going to severely impair an enemy's ability to do pretty much anything for 1000 time units. Effects everything except the dog, so try not to stand too close.
